πŸ“Š The Sage Story

Sage is a distinctive girls' name in United States, ranking #501 in 1999 with 521 recorded births. The name reached its all-time peak in 2022 with 2,013 births ranking #143. Since 1996, the popularity has increased by 54.6%. In 1999, approximately 1 in every 3,405 girls born was named Sage. STABLE Recent data shows the name is currently stable.

Name Meaning & Origin

Origin: English word name from Latin roots  |  Meaning: wise; sage herb

Sage is a clean modern name that combines the ideas of wisdom and the herb of the same name. It feels crisp, balanced, and highly versatile.

The name rose as short word and nature names became fashionable, especially those with a calm intelligent tone. Its strength lies in having both plant and virtue-like associations at once.

Did you know?Sage is one of the few modern word names that feels equally natural as a nature name and a quality name.
